Overview

A Podcast & Audio Production Technician is a professional who focuses on the technical aspects of creating, recording, editing, and producing audio content, such as podcasts, audiobooks, radio broadcasts, or soundtracks. This role emphasizes the operation of audio equipment, sound engineering, and post-production processes to ensure high-quality output, often supporting content creators or producers. With the increasing popularity of digital audio content in India, this career has emerged as a vital vocational path in the media and entertainment industry. Roles and Responsibilities

a) Technical Responsibilities (Recording & Setup):

  • Set up and operate audio recording equipment, including microphones, mixers, audio interfaces, and digital audio workstations (DAWs) in studio or field environments.
  • Test and maintain equipment to ensure optimal performance, troubleshooting issues like sound distortion, connectivity problems, or hardware malfunctions.
  • Record audio content for podcasts, interviews, or narrations, adjusting levels and monitoring sound quality to capture clear and balanced audio.
  • Provide technical support during live recordings or streaming sessions, ensuring minimal disruptions and consistent audio output.
  • Collaborate with podcast hosts, producers, or directors to meet specific audio requirements, such as ambient sound capture or voice modulation.

b) Post-Production and Editing Responsibilities:

  • Edit raw audio files using software like Audacity, Adobe Audition, or Reaper to remove background noise, correct pitch, and enhance clarity.
  • Mix and master audio tracks, balancing vocals, music, and sound effects to create a polished final product suitable for various playback devices.
  • Add intros, outros, transitions, and advertisements as per project guidelines, ensuring seamless integration into the content.
  • Prepare audio files for distribution by formatting them for podcast platforms (e.g., Spotify, Apple Podcasts) and adding metadata or tags for discoverability.
  • Archive recordings and maintain backups to prevent data loss and ensure accessibility for future use or re-editing.

c) Administrative and Support Responsibilities:

  • Assist in scheduling recording sessions, managing studio bookings, and coordinating equipment availability for multiple projects.
  • Document technical setups, editing processes, and equipment logs to support team collaboration and project continuity.
  • Support marketing efforts by providing audio snippets or teasers for social media promotion of podcasts or audio content.
  • Stay updated on audio technology advancements, software updates, and platform requirements to maintain relevance and efficiency in workflows.
  • Ensure compliance with copyright laws and licensing for music or sound effects used in productions to avoid legal issues.
